The Roadmap to Career Advancement: Expert Tips for Steady Growth

In today’s rapidly evolving professional landscape, career advancement has become more important than ever. As competition intensifies, it is crucial for individuals to have a roadmap to navigate their careers and achieve steady growth. Whether you are a recent graduate starting your career or a seasoned professional looking to take the next step, here are some expert tips to help you in your journey towards career advancement.

1. Self-assessment: The first step towards career advancement is to take stock of your skills, interests, and goals. Identify your strengths and weaknesses and explore opportunities that align with your passions. Understanding your own motivations and aspirations will allow you to make more informed decisions and pursue the right path.

2. Lifelong learning: In today’s fast-paced world, continuous learning is essential for career growth. Invest in your professional development by attending workshops, seminars, or online courses. Seek opportunities to gain new skills and knowledge that will set you apart from your peers. Staying up to date with the latest industry trends and technologies will make you a valuable asset in any organization.

3. Set clear goals: To advance in your career, it is crucial to set clear, achievable goals. Start by defining short-term and long-term objectives that align with your career aspirations. Break them down into actionable steps and create a timeline to track your progress. Regularly evaluate and adjust your goals based on new opportunities and changing circumstances.

4. Seek mentorship: Having a mentor can significantly accelerate your career growth. A mentor is someone with more experience and wisdom who can guide and support you as you navigate your professional journey. Seek out mentors within your industry or organization who can offer valuable insights, advice, and help you make connections.

5. Expand your network: Building a strong professional network is vital for career advancement. Attend industry events, join professional organizations, and engage with colleagues and peers. Networking not only opens doors to new opportunities but also allows you to learn from others’ experiences and gain valuable industry insights.

6. Take on new challenges: Stepping out of your comfort zone and taking on new challenges is essential for career advancement. Volunteer for projects that require new skills or responsibilities, take on leadership roles, or explore cross-functional opportunities. Embrace opportunities to learn, grow, and demonstrate your abilities beyond your current role.

7. Effective communication: Strong communication skills are vital for career advancement. Whether it is communicating your ideas, building relationships, or presenting your work, being an effective communicator will set you apart. Focus on honing your verbal and written communication skills to ensure that your ideas are conveyed clearly and concisely.

8. Showcase your achievements: As you progress in your career, it is important to showcase your accomplishments. Document your successes, both big and small, and highlight them in your resume, online profile, or during performance reviews. Quantify your achievements whenever possible to provide tangible evidence of your impact.

9. Embrace feedback: Constructive feedback is a valuable tool for self-improvement. Take feedback graciously and use it as an opportunity to grow. Seek feedback from your superiors, colleagues, and mentors on a regular basis, and use their insights to refine your skills and strategies.

10. Maintain work-life balance: Finally, maintaining a healthy work-life balance is crucial for long-term career growth. Burnout and stress can hinder your progress, so make sure to prioritize self-care and set boundaries. Take breaks, engage in hobbies, and spend quality time with loved ones to recharge and maintain your overall well-being.

Building a successful career takes time, commitment, and perseverance. By following these expert tips for steady growth, you can navigate the road to career advancement with confidence and set yourself on a path towards success. Remember, every step forward, no matter how small, brings you closer to achieving your professional goals.
